Following the isotropic elastic reverse time migration (rtm), an elastic rtm method for vti media is proposed. the proposed method exploits polarization vector projection to separate anisotropic elastic wavefields.

We use elastic least squares reverse time migration (lsrtm) to invert for the reflectivity images of p and s wave impedances. elastic lsrtm solves the linearized elastic wave equations for forward modeling and the adjoint equations for backpropagating the residual wavefield at each iteration.
